Output 43821bcdc2066dc9defab22f89f52885f5cb84b56bd14ed4de204f0a3dc388b4:0

value
143469329
script pubkey
OP_0 OP_PUSHBYTES_20 51f05ef9d791b805bfeead46afe44867b1e0fe7d
address
ltc1q28c9a7whjxuqt0lw44r2lezgv7c7plnaljpaf3
transaction
43821bcdc2066dc9defab22f89f52885f5cb84b56bd14ed4de204f0a3dc388b4
spent
true